ok, reading from where it knocked the most (around sample 76301) your TP was @ 30%, MAP 61..22, knock retard front 3.75 and the advances were @ 26.5 and 27.5, pretty close to each other but below what your table asks, so I would guess the ECU is pulling timing from both cylinders... notice that your tables are different and there is like 4 degrees less on the rear table on that region you are riding.
in your shoes I would copy the rear table over the front one and see what happens. or perhaps just pull the advances that are higher on the front to the (lower) values on the rear, but not touch the ones that are lower already... timing can be a PITA.

If the spark you are getting is lower than what is called out in main spark table. Check with the other tables that can control spark. Spark Temp Correction and IAT Spark Correction. This also needs to be correlated with MAP and RPM along with temps.

Guys... I appreciate all the input here. I tried quick tune to add fuel and take out timing in the mid and high range.... I added 3% to mid and 5% to high for fuel and took out -3 degrees in the mid and -5 in the high range and took it out for a test run....
I set a 4 pack Guage to read RPM, MAP, SPARK KNOCK HITS front and rear and SPARK KNOCK DEG.
This helped me to get closer to a solution.... after the changes above were flashed in, spark knock hits were greatly reduced, but not gone.
I think I'm on the right track... I followed the SPARK KNOCK AND PINGING pdf in the dyno jet download section.... and applied it to what you are all telling me.
I am going to run some more logs and play with fuel and timing in the quick tune a bit more
